I have just finished assembling an upper with all RRA parts.  I used a 16 R4 countour barrell, RRA bolt carrier and charging handle, RRA upper receiver, delta ring, and gas tube.  

Is it going to matter that the upper receiver does not have the relief cuts/extensions in it like my factory built entry tactical?  Essentially what I did was buld a Entry Tactical with no cuts in the receiver, and I did not think about the cuts until I had already purchased the parts.  

While this was fun to do, I think next time I'll just buy a complete rifle from you again, or the kit.  I put this upper on a factory built lower that I purchased from a local dealer and the fit is tight, real tight.  Very hard to get rear pin in, you have to work at it.  Is this normal?, will it loosen up once I shoot it?

If you have any feeding issues with what you'll be shooting out of it, you may have to extend the ramps, but otherwise, don't worry about it.  We do it to ensure feeding with just about any bullet type.
